The Snow on the Footsteps (1942 film)
1942 film / From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
The Snow on the Footsteps (French: La neige sur les pas) is a 1942 French drama film directed by André Berthomieu and starring Pierre Blanchar, Michèle Alfa and Georges Lannes.[1] [2] It was based on the 1911 novel of the same title by Henry Bordeaux.[3] The film's sets were designed by the art director Robert Giordani. The novel had previously been adapted into the 1923 silent film The Snow on the Footsteps.
